Title: Arne Bjornberg: Innovator in Environmental Solutions
Introduction
Arne Bjornberg is a notable inventor based in Skelleftehamn, Sweden. He has made significant contributions to environmental technology, particularly in the treatment of contaminated materials. With a total of 3 patents, his work focuses on innovative methods to address pressing environmental issues.
Latest Patents
One of his latest patents involves a method for treating mercury-contaminated lakes. This invention aims to lower the mercury content in fish by supplying selenium in the form of a selenium salt, which is incorporated into a carrier material. This carrier material is designed to dispense selenium to the surrounding water in a controlled manner. The method ensures that an effective selenium level is maintained below 10 µg.
Another significant patent by Bjornberg pertains to the processing of copper smelting materials. This invention outlines a method for preparing a sulphidic concentrate that contains high percentages of arsenic and/or antimony. The process involves partially roasting the concentrate in a fluidized bed to eliminate these impurities, thereby facilitating further processing to extract copper and precious metals.
